Title: CATS Special Transportation Services Vehicle Parts

Title

CATS Special Transportation Services Vehicle Parts

 

Action

Action:

A.                     Approve a unit price contract with Vendor Maintenance Program, Inc. for the purchase of Chevrolet Special Transportation Services Bus Parts for a term of three years, and

 

B.                     Authorize the City Manager to renew the contracts for up to two, one-year terms with possible price adjustments and to amend the contracts consistent with the purpose for which the contracts were approved.

Explanation

§                     Charlotte Area Transit System-Bus Operations Division (CATS-BOD) maintains a fleet of special transportation vehicles, which currently consists of approximately 90 buses and approximately 55 Chevrolet Express 4500 vehicles.

§                     CATS-BOD uses original equipment manufacturer (OEM) bus parts in the daily maintenance and repair of fleet vehicles.

§                     OEM parts meet the required specifications and standards to keep the buses and fleet vehicles in proper operating condition and maintain the vehicles’ warranties.

§                     On January 27, 2025, the city issued an Invitation to Bid; three bids were received.

§                     Vendor Maintenance Program, Inc. was selected as the lowest responsive, responsible bidder.

§                     Annual expenditures are estimated to be $131,759.

 

Charlotte Business INClusion

Contract goals were not established for this contract because there were no certified MWSBEs available within the city’s database capable of performing the required work or providing the necessary goods. This determination was made based on a comprehensive search by CBI and relevant departments, utilizing the city’s vendor registration system, relevant market research, and an assessment of the work required by the contract.

 

Fiscal Note

Funding:  CATS Operating Budget
